Q: What's the difference between composite toe and steel toe?
A: Composite toe caps are made from non-metal materials like carbon fiber or Kevlar, making them lighter than steel while still meeting ASTM safety standards. They're also non-conductive, won't set off metal detectors, and provide better insulation in extreme temperatures.
